Understanding How Bowling Alley Oil Machines Work
Bowling alley oil machines play a crucial role in the sport of bowling by applying a specific pattern of oil to the lane surface. This oil affects how the ball behaves as it rolls down the lane, impacting factors such as hook, skid, and overall performance. Understanding the mechanics of these machines and the oil patterns they create can significantly enhance a bowler’s game.
The oil is typically made from a blend of mineral oils and additives that help it adhere to the lane. The machine uses a series of nozzles to distribute the oil evenly across the lane, following a predetermined pattern. This pattern can be adjusted based on the desired lane conditions, which can vary greatly depending on the skill level of the bowlers or the type of competition.
One of the key aspects of can bowling is the concept of lane surface friction. Oil reduces friction between the bowling ball and the lane, allowing the ball to travel further before hooking. When the oil is applied, it creates a slick surface that helps the ball slide easily, but as the game progresses, the oil wears off, altering the lane conditions. Good bowlers need to adapt to these changes to maintain their performance.
Oil machines are typically programmed to apply different patterns such as ‘house patterns,’ which are generally easier for amateur bowlers, or ‘sport patterns,’ which are designed to challenge even the most skilled players. Bowlers who understand how these patterns affect their shot execution can adjust their techniques accordingly, enhancing their ability to score.

The Importance of Oil Patterns in Bowling Performance
The oil patterns applied by bowling alley oil machines play a crucial role in determining the overall performance of bowlers on the lanes. These patterns affect how the bowling ball interacts with the lane surface, influencing factors such as hook, speed, and accuracy. Understanding these patterns is essential for players seeking to improve their game.
Bowling alleys typically utilize different oil patterns, which can be broadly categorized into three types:
Oil Pattern Type | Description | Impact on Performance |
---|---|---|
House Patterns | Commonly found in recreational centers, designed to favor a wide range of bowlers. | Allows for a greater margin of error, making it easier for beginners. |
Sport Patterns | Challenging patterns used in competitive bowling, designed for advanced players. | Requires precision and skill, often resulting in lower scores for unprepared bowlers. |
Custom Patterns | Tailored oil patterns based on specific lane conditions or bowler preferences. | Offers unique challenges and advantages based on individual strategy. |
By understanding the significance of these oil patterns, bowlers can adapt their techniques accordingly. For instance, if they are competing on a challenging sport pattern, they may need to adjust their ball speed, angle of entry, and release techniques to maximize their scores.
Moreover, the right choice of bowling ball can further enhance performance based on the oil pattern. A ball designed for heavy oil will react differently than one meant for dry conditions, making it essential for bowlers to consider their equipment in relation to the lane conditions.

Frequently Asked Questions
What is the role of oil in bowling alleys?
Oil on the lanes influences ball behavior, affecting how it hooks or slides, which can significantly impact a bowler’s performance.
How does the oil pattern affect bowling strategy?
Different oil patterns create unique challenges; bowlers must adjust their angles, speed, and ball type to compensate for these patterns.
Can different oil machines create different oil patterns?
Yes, various oil machines have different capabilities and settings that can produce a wide range of oil patterns, influencing how the ball interacts with the lane.
What are some common types of oil patterns used in bowling?
Common oil patterns include house patterns, sport patterns, and custom patterns, each affecting gameplay differently.
